“建筑材料”实验课虚拟实验辅助教学研究

Study on Virtual Experiment Supplementary Teaching of “Construction Materials” Laboratory Course

  • 摘要: 基于建筑材料实验课目前存在的问题,以虚拟实验辅助教学补充、替代传统的实验教学。在研究总结国内外文献资料的基础上,阐述建筑材料虚拟实验室的设计思路、实验室平台的组成及功能,并分析虚拟辅助实验教学的优势,即利用虚拟实验教学,能丰富实验内容,提高学生实验设计的能力,增强学生学习兴趣并缩短实验时间,对提高学生的实践能力、提高实验课的效率等方面都具有重要的意义。

     

    Abstract: Based on the existing problems of the construction materials laboratory course at present, using the virtual experiment assisted the teaching supplement, replacing the traditional experimental teaching. On the basis of summarizing the domestic and foreign literatures, this paper elaborates the design ideas of the virtual laboratory of building materials, the composition and function of the laboratory platform. The advantages of virtual assistant experiment teaching are analyzed. Namely, the use of virtual experiment teaching can improve the students' ability of experiment design, enrich the experimental content, enhance learning interest and shorten the experiment time. At the same time, it is also of great significance to improve the students' practical ability and improve the efficiency of experiment course.
